Beltikri Population - Korba, Chhattisgarh

Beltikri is a medium size village located in Katghora Tehsil of Korba district, Chhattisgarh with total 314 families residing. The Beltikri village has population of 1437 of which 768 are males while 669 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Beltikri village population of children with age 0-6 is 244 which makes up 16.98 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Beltikri village is 871 which is lower than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Beltikri as per census is 1159, higher than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Beltikri village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Beltikri village was 86.00 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Beltikri Male literacy stands at 94.35 % while female literacy rate was 75.84 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 16.21 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 6.47 % of total population in Beltikri village.

Work Profile

In Beltikri village out of total population, 436 were engaged in work activities. 91.06 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 8.94 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 436 workers engaged in Main Work, 6 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 6 were Agricultural labourer.
